Mohammad Zakaria Chowdhury Director, Sylhet IT Academy Freelancing with Website Development

Preview:

Citation preview

Mohammad Zakaria Chowdhury

Director, Sylhet IT Academy

Freelancing withWebsite Development

Overview1. Website Template Design

2. Static WebsiteHTMLCSSJavascript

3. Dynamic WebsitePHPMySQL

1. Website Template Design

Website Template DesignNecessary Software

Photoshop (PSD File)Illustrator

Design Idea fromwww.ThemeForest.net

Learn Fromhttp://psd.tutsplus.comhttp://webdesign.tutsplus.com

Website Template DesignDesign Theory

Web 2.0Z LayoutF LayoutColor TheoryVisual Hierarchy

Z Layout

Z Layout

F Layout

F Layout

Projects - Template DesignGet Projects From

oDesk (5601 Projects, $5-$8/Hour)Freelancer (1855 Projects)Elance (1589 Projects, $5-15/Hour)Price: $50 - $500

Sell Templates toThemeForest.net (446 Items)Price: $5 - $10 (Maximum: 344 Sales => $1720)

2. Static Website

Static Website - HTMLWhat is HTML?

Hyper Text Markup LanguageHTML is not a programming languageIt is a markup languageA markup language is a set of markup tagsHTML uses markup tags to describe web

pagesLearn From

www.w3schoos.com

Static Website - CSSWhat is CSS?

Cascading Style SheetsStyles define how to display HTML elementsCSS can save a lot of design workTo create similar design for all pages of a websiteReusable & Easily CustomizableWebsite design can be change by changing CSS

FrameworkCSS Blueprint / 960 Grid System

Static Website - JavascriptWhat is Javascript

JavaScript was designed to add interactivity to HTML

JavaScript is a client side scripting language

JavaScripts are executed on the browserA scripting language is a lightweight

programming languageFramework

JQuery

Projects – PSD to HTMLGet Projects From

oDesk (339 Projects, $10/Hour)Freelancer (67 Projects)Elance (107 Projects, Less than $500)Price: $50 - $500

Sell Templates toThemeForest.net (2374 Items)Price: $3 - $25 (Maximum: 3235 Sales => $32,350)

3. Dynamic Website

Dynamic Website - PHPWhat is PHP?

PHP: Hypertext PreprocessorPHP is a server-side scripting languagePHP scripts are executed on the serverPHP supports many databases (MySQL,

Oracle)PHP is an open source software

Learn Fromwww.w3schools.comhttp://net.tutsplus.com

Dynamic Website - MySQLWhat is MySQL?

MySQL is a database serverMySQL is ideal for both small and large

applicationsMySQL supports standard SQL

How to Start?Install Apache Server > XAMPPwww.w3schools.com

Open Source ScriptsCodeIgniterWordpressJoomlaosCommerceMagento

Projects – PHP/MySQLGet Projects From

oDesk (8620 Projects, $5-$15/Hour)Freelancer (2429 Projects)Elance (2332 Projects)Price: $50 - $5,000

Sell Templates toThemeForest.net (1464 Wordpress Items)Price: $12 - $60 (Max: 9422 Sales => $1,64,885)

For More InformationBlog - http://freelancerstory.blogspot.comSite - http://www.sylhetitacademy.comGroup -

groups.google.com/group/bdosn_outsourcing

Thank You

Recommended